Output 21caa41409428296fa6c723e5c5c71df1fac18c72d77182e390c9d4f5cef09a2:2

value
192150
script pubkey
OP_0 OP_PUSHBYTES_20 323620926f30d8ac59cef5d9827bd089ad6025ad
address
tb1qxgmzpyn0xrv2ckww7hvcy77s3xkkqfdd7msc3f
transaction
21caa41409428296fa6c723e5c5c71df1fac18c72d77182e390c9d4f5cef09a2
confirmations
81862
spent
true